The aerospace valves market is expected to be worth US$10.8 billion in 2023. Aerospace valve sales are expected to produce over US$17.6 billion in revenue by 2033. The market is expected to increase at a CAGR of 5% over the forecast period.

Over the past few years, the aerospace valves industry has grown significantly, propelled by a number of factors. Commercial aircraft production has increased as a result of rising global demand for air travel. The expansion of the defense industry and space exploration initiatives has also aided the development of the sector.

Key Takeaways from the Market:

  • During the projected period, the United States aerospace valves industry is predicted to rise at a CAGR of 4.8%. Reaching a market value of US$ 3.1 Billion by 2033.
  • The aerospace valves industry in the United Kingdom is estimated to reach US$0.6 Billion by 2033. Increasing at a CAGR of 4.7% from 2023 to 2033.
  • The Chinese aerospace valves industry is expected to reach US$ 2.7 Billion by 2033.
  • The Japanese aerospace valves industry is estimated to be worth US$ 2.6 Billion by 2033, due to a 4.7% CAGR between 2023 and 2033.
  • The aerospace valves industry in South Korea is anticipated to be worth US$ 0.8 Billion by 2033.
  • Steel is expected to be the dominant material segment in the aerospace valves industry, with a CAGR of 6.2% from 2023 to 2033.
  • Check valves are predicted to lead the aerospace valves industry with a CAGR of 5.8% during the forecast period.

How are Key Players Soaring High in the Aerospace Valves Industry?

The aerospace valves industry is extremely competitive, with just a select few companies holding a huge market share. Companies like Parker Hannifin, Honeywell, Moog, and Crane are at the forefront of their respective fields. These businesses are continually making investments in research and development. Moreover, product diversification and strategic alliances ensure that they retain their market dominance.

The increase in regulation in the sector is one of the key obstacles these businesses confront. New entrants may find it challenging to get into the aerospace sector due to the industry’s stringent rules and certification requirements. Existing market leaders, however, have a higher chance of surviving these changes in the law and maintaining their dominant position.
